Mujahid Khan Slams BJP MP For Communal Statements

Khan questioned the BJP MP’s alleged repeated targeting of madrasas and the Muslim community under the guise of national security.

Hyderabad:Congress senior leader Mujahid Alam Khan on Wednesday strongly condemned the recent spate of what he called “inflammatory and communal statements” made by BJP Medak MP M. Raghunandan Rao.

Terming them a deliberate attempt to stoke fear and polarise society on religious lines, Khan said the BJP MP’s remarks reflected not only a dangerous mindset but also complete disregard for constitutional governance.

Khan questioned the BJP MP’s alleged repeated targeting of madrasas and the Muslim community under the guise of national security. “It appears that Raghunandan Rao has forgotten that the BJP has been in power at the Centre since 2014. If there is any illegal infiltration of Bangladeshi or Pakistani nationals in Hyderabad, then what has the Union home ministry been doing all these years,” he asked. Khan said these were baseless allegations which were not only misleading but a direct question mark on the efficiency of Union home minister Amit Shah and minister of state Bandi Sanjay.

Ridiculing Raghunandan Rao’s demand that Chief Minister A. Revanth Reddy disclose the number of illegal foreign nationals and madrasas in the state, Khan said, “The data of foreigners, including Pakistanis and Bangladeshis, is maintained by the Union ministry of external affairs, which is under the BJP government. If the BJP MP is so concerned, he should write to Amit Shah and Dr S. Jaishankar instead of trying to provoke the public.”
